She chooses one and flunks him. Shocked, he comes to her after class, begging for a retest. She convinces him to come to her house after school for "private tutoring" so he can pass her class. Once he is there, however, she uses a variety of techniques to induce hysterical blindness (i.e., she blinds him with science). He can only see her, and think she is "beautiful," but this is due to some "chemicals" which he can only smell and "machinery," which he can only hear. Another technique of hers involves hypnosis. Her eyes are "tender" and "deep," and she dances seductively. Before long, she is "dancing close to" and "making love to" (note the passive grammar on their part) her students. Recalling the situation later, they can recall nothing specific that could incriminate her, due to their inability to "see" their surroundings. She also destroys the physical evidence: "She's tidied up and I can't find anything/ All my... careful notes." Before enough accusations collect, she tells the administration, "I can't live like this," and quits, moving on to another one of the thousands of high schools in the country-- with the former school's high recommendations (so that she doesn't sue them for libel). |
